使用は可能ですが推奨しておりません。
なぜ推奨しないのか
URL やファイル名に日本語(マルチバイト文字)を使用した場合、以下の問題が発生する可能性があります。
- ジェネレート時のエラー:静的ファイルの生成処理で日本語を含むパスの解決に失敗し、該当ページが 404 になる場合があります
- ブラウザ・ツールによる表示の差異:日本語 URL はパーセントエンコード(例:
%E6%97%A5%E6%9C%AC%E8%AA%9E)に変換されるため、SNS やメールで共有した際に可読性が低下します - 外部サービスとの連携問題:Analytics や検索エンジンクローラーによっては、エンコードされた URL を正しく処理できない場合があります
- 画像・メディアファイル:日本語ファイル名でアップロードした画像は、ページ生成時に正しく参照されないことがあります
問題が発生した場合の対処
ジェネレートエラーやアクセス時に 404 が発生した場合は、以下の手順で対処してください。
記事・ページの URL(パーマリンク)の場合
- WordPress 管理画面で該当の記事・ページを開く
- パーマリンクを半角英数字に変更して保存する
- 再度ジェネレートを実行する
画像・メディアファイルの場合
- 該当ファイルをメディアライブラリから削除する
- ファイル名を半角英数字・ハイフン・アンダースコアのみに変更してから再アップロードする
- 記事内の参照先を新しい URL に更新した上でジェネレートを実行する
推奨する命名規則
| 項目 | 推奨 | 非推奨 |
|---|---|---|
| 記事スラッグ | my-article-title | 私の記事タイトル |
| 画像ファイル名 | product-image-01.jpg | 商品画像01.jpg |
| カテゴリスラッグ | news | ニュース |